Karin L. Zimmermann is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Plant Science and Food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Karin L. Zimmermann has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 340 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 4 papers in Plant Science and 3 papers in Food Science. Recurrent topics in Karin L. Zimmermann’s work include Consumer Attitudes and Food Labeling (4 papers), Nutritional Studies and Diet (3 papers) and Culinary Culture and Tourism (2 papers). Karin L. Zimmermann is often cited by papers focused on Consumer Attitudes and Food Labeling (4 papers), Nutritional Studies and Diet (3 papers) and Culinary Culture and Tourism (2 papers). Karin L. Zimmermann coll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ands, United Kingdom and Italy. Karin L. Zimmermann's co-authors include I.A. van der Lans, Davide Menozzi, Lynn J. Frewer, A.R.H. Fischer, Machiel J. Reinders, Xiaoyong Zhang, Hans van Meijl, K.J. Poppe, S.J. Sijtsema and Adrian Leip and has published in prestigious journals such as Trends in Food Science & Technology, LWT and Agricultural Systems.
